2.5 Wear suitable clothing

Loose-fitting clothing increases the danger of being caught or
being drawn in on rotating parts, and the risk of getting caught
on protruding parts. You can be severely injured or killed in
these cases.

– Wear closely fitting clothing.

– Do not wear any rings, chains or any other jewelry.

– Wear a hair net if you have long hair.

– Wear work safety shoes.

2.6 Fire-fighting / Extinguishing a fire

Use a powder extinguisher that corresponds to fire class B as
per EN 2 to extinguish any fires / to fight fires.

Maintain a minimum safe distance from electrical components.
For a mains voltage of up to 1000 V, the minimum safe dis-
tance is 1 m.
